OTHER EVENTS On January 24, 1996, the Company reported 1995 net income of $26.6 million, with income to common stock of $11.8 million (or approximately $0.13 per share), compared with 1994 net income of $17.1 million and income to common stock of $5.4 million (or approximately $0.06 per share). Revenues for 1995 totaled $442.0 million, compared with $391.4 million in 1994. For the fourth quarter of 1995, the Company reported net income of $8.4 million, with income attributable to common stock of $4.7 million (or approximately $0.05 per share), compared with net income of $4.5 million and income attributable to common stock of $0.8 million (or approximately $0.01 per share) for the same period in 1994. Revenues for the quarter totaled $122.6 million compared with $97.8 million in the fourth quarter of 1994, primarily due to increased production of both oil and gas and to the recognition of the settlement of a disputed gas sales contract during the quarter. Total production in 1995 was 33.3 million oil equivalent barrels compared to 32.3 million oil equivalent barrels in 1994. Oil production for 1995 averaged 66,300 barrels per day compared to 65,700 barrels per day in 1994. Natural gas production in 1995 averaged 150.0 million cubic feet per day compared to 136.6 million cubic feet per day in 1994. Oil production in the fourth quarter of 1995 averaged 68,400 barrels per day compared to 64,800 barrels per day in the fourth quarter of 1994. Natural gas production in the fourth quarter of 1995 averaged 160.2 million cubic feet per day compared to 125.1 million cubic feet per day in the fourth quarter of 1994. Oil prices recognized by the Company in 1995 averaged $14.15 per barrel, including a $0.10 per barrel benefit from oil price hedging, compared with $12.41 per barrel recognized in 1994 without any price hedging. Natural gas prices recognized by the Company during 1995 averaged $1.43 per thousand cubic feet ("Mcf"), net of a $0.01 per Mcf hedging expense, compared with $1.73 Mcf in 1994, net of $0.02 per Mcf hedging expense. In the fourth quarter of 1995, crude oil prices recognized by the Company averaged $13.43 per barrel, net of a $0.10 per barrel hedging expense, compared with $13.22 per barrel in the 1994 period without any oil price hedging. Natural gas prices recognized during the fourth quarter of 1995 averaged $1.64 per Mcf, net of a $0.02 per Mcf hedging expense, compared with $1.43 during the 1994 period without any natural gas price hedging. Costs and expenses in 1995 totaled $388.1 million, compared with $343.2 million in 1994, with the increase primarily due to a $30.2 million impairment charge against producing properties in the fourth quarter of 1995 that was associated with adoption of a new accounting standard. Costs and expenses totaled $123.5 million in the 1995 fourth quarter compared with $81.5 million in the fourth quarter of 1994. -2- 3 SANTA FE ENERGY RESOURCES, INC.
